ISLAMABAD, (UrduPoint / Pakistan Point News - 6th Oct, 2018 ) :The weather experts have indicated that a fresh westerly wave will affect the upper parts of the country from Monday and produce light rain till Tuesday which would further decrease the night temperatures.
Talking to APP, Meteorologist, Pakistan Meteorological Department (PMD), Rashid Bilal revealed that the fresh westerly wave will enter the country's upper parts and produce rain on Monday and Tuesday morning.
He said the night temperatures are expected to further fall during this upcoming spell while the day temperatures will fall during the next rain spell.
Comparing the present weather conditions with the last years' October weather, Rashid Bilal revealed that the month of October and November during the last year were mainly dry and Winter started with delay.
However, the met department has forecast three rain spells during the month of October this year which reflect early onset of chilly Winter season, he said.
The reasons for these abrupt changes in weather systems he attributed to global climate factors, impacts of changes in North Atlantic and Indian Ocean, El Nino and La Nino etc. The weather is moving in positive direction, Rashid Bilal observed.
According to the Pakistan Meteorological Department (PMD) report, dry weather will prevail in most parts of the country during Sunday.
The synoptic situation indicated prevalence of continental air over most parts of the country while a fresh westerly wave is likely to enter upper parts of the country from Monday.
The weather will remain dry in most parts of Punjab, Khyber Pakhtunkhwa, Sindh, Balochistan, Kashmir and Gilgit Baltistan during Sunday.
The rainfall recorded during the last 24 hours in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a was Kalam 12 mm, Dir 04, Pattan, Mirkhani, Drosh 03, Chitral 01 and Punjab: Muree 01 mm.
The maximum highest temperatures recorded during the period were Mithi, Tandojam, Chhor and, Turbat 41 C.
